In the practical art of war, the best thing of all is to take the enemys country whole and intact.

Sunzi, wadegiles romanization sun tzu, also spelled sun tzu, personal name sun wu, flourished 5th century bc, reputed author of the chinese classic bingfa the art of war, the earliest known treatise on war and military science. Reconstructed from bamboo strips recovered three decades ago from a newly opened han dynasty tomb, the military methods as we have titled it in translation to distinguish it from sun tzus art of war is attributed to sun pin sun bin, the illfated heroic strategist who formulated the measures through which chi, the powerful eastern coastal state whose military heritage extended back.
